MAINSTREAM LOUDOUN v. BOARD OF TRUSTEES OF LOUDOUN

Civil Action No. 97-2049-A.

2 F.Supp.2d 783 (1998)

MAINSTREAM LOUDOUN, et al., Plaintiffs, v. BOARD OF TRUSTEES OF THE LOUDOUN COUNTY LIBRARY, et al., Defendants.

United States District Court, E.D. Virginia, Alexandria Division.

April 7, 1998.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Robert Corn-Revere, Hogan & Hartson, Washington, DC, for Plaintiff.

Kenneth Bass III, Venable, Baetjer & Howard, McLean, VA, for Defendant.


MEMORANDUM OPINION AND ORDER

BRINKEMA, District Judge.

Before the Court are defendants' Motion to Dismiss the Individual Defendants and Motion to Dismiss for Failure to State a Claim or, in the Alternative, for Summary Judgment, in a case of first impression, involving the applicability of the First Amendment's free speech clause to public libraries' content-based restrictions on Internet access.
